From the ordinance
Directory sign. A single sign, or a set of similarly designed individual signs placed or displayed in sequence and which may provide information in a list, roster, or directory format. (c) The sign area of any directory sign shall not exceed sixteen (16) square feet and, if freestanding, shall not exceed six (6) feet in height.
